Blast Testing of Full-Scale, Precast, Prestressed Concrete Girder Bridges
The objective of this research project are to: (1) assess the damage done to precast, prestressed girder bridges from a blast generated below the girders; (2) compare this damage with a blast generated on top of the bridge deck; and (3) develop recommendations for possible mitigation measures that would harden this type of bridge blast damage.
